JV-580: Notice to Child and Parent/Guardian RE: Release of Juvenile Police Records and Objection

Fillable PDFJudicial Council of California

This form notifies a child and their parent or guardian that their juvenile police records may be released to certain people or organizations, and gives them a chance to object to that release. Police departments, courts, and schools use this form to inform families about their right to prevent juvenile arrest records from being shared with employers, colleges, or other third parties.
